1、修改完成Nginx配置文件之后需要重啟服務 2、如果代理配置正確,此時在瀏覽器中輸入 localhost 打開 其中展示的內容應該是 localhost:8080 下的頁面內容 在瀏覽器中輸入 localhost/apis/report/data.json 展示的內容 ...
文章來源:http: to u.xyz nginx cors 背景描述 最近在研究RESTful API接口設計,使用的是Nginx,要實現本地http: . . . 跨域訪問服務器端http: api.zlzkj.com,並且要支持DELETEPUT等請求。 跨域配置 只需要在Nginx配置文件里加入以下配置,即可開啟跨域 代表任何域都可以訪問,可以改成只允許某個域訪問,如Access Cont ...
2017-12-06 14:29 1 5602 推薦指數:
1、修改完成Nginx配置文件之后需要重啟服務 2、如果代理配置正確,此時在瀏覽器中輸入 localhost 打開 其中展示的內容應該是 localhost:8080 下的頁面內容 在瀏覽器中輸入 localhost/apis/report/data.json 展示的內容 ...
自己做網站的時候,經常遇到跨域問題,下面是平時多次實踐總結出的解決方法,大家有什么更好的思路,可以相互交流下~ XMLHttpRequest cannot load http://www.imooc.com/data/check_f.php. ...
AJAX跨域的問題很常見,有較多的解決辦法如:jsonp,設置服務端允許跨域,給請求加代理等等解決方式,我項目中常用node.js搭建中間代理的方式解決。下面我將嘗試采用nginx做代理的方式解決跨域的問題。 第一步:搭建Server API,其中未設置允許跨域。get方法,返回英雄列表 ...
from:https://blog.csdn.net/wang379275614/article/details/53333775 上篇文章提到,由於瀏覽器的同源策略,使得,AJAX請求只能發給同源的網址,否則就報錯。除了架設服務器代理,如Nginx(瀏覽器請求同源服務器,再由后者請求外部 ...
webapi在配置文件中加入這幾句就可以解決ajax(同源策略是JavaScript里面的限制,其他的編程語言,比如在C#,Java或者iOS等其他語言中是可以調用外部的WebService,也就是 說,如果開發Native應用,是不存在這個問題的,但是如果開發Web或者Html5如WebApp ...
今天遇到一個ajax跨域問題,下拉框的數據源要從一個接口獲得,但是該接口被部署到另外一台服務器上,在本地可以通過http請求訪問,並可以返回json的數據,但是放到頁面中不可以獲取到下拉框的值,發現chrome控制台中該請求成功,但是沒有返回值,於是便遇到了跨域的問題,請教一同事,問題得到解決 ...
域的問題,除了可以用jsonp的請求模式,並且在后台支持回調的方式以外,還可以通過簡單的配置webco ...
今天用sanic寫前后端分離的項目時,用pycharm本地調試遇到ajax跨域問題。從網上搜索解決方案,用getJSON,jsonp,設置請求頭等均達不到理想效果。最后,想到可以利用nginx反向代理來解決這個問題。 注意:兩個url只要協議、域名、端口有任何一個不同,都被當作 ...